The 10-Mbps Standard Ethernet has gone through several changes before moving to higher data rates. The new designs include:

Fast Ethernet:

  • Fast Ethernet Ethernet was designed to compete with LAN protocols such as FDDI or Fiber Channel Channel.
  • IEEE created Fast Ethernet Ethernet under the name 802.3u.
  • Fast Ethernet Ethernet is backward backward-compatible compatible with Standard Standard Ethernet Ethernet, but it can transmit data 10 times faster at a rate of 100 Mbps.
